Myocarditis is a serious heart condition. It involves inflammation of the heart’s muscular layer. This can cause mild to severe complications.

Definition and Basic Concepts

Myocarditis is an inflammatory heart muscle condition. It can be caused by infections, autoimmune diseases, or toxins. The heart muscle damage can affect its function. The severity of myocarditis can vary significantly, from mild to severe heart failure.

Types of Myocarditis

Myocarditis can be classified into different types. Lymphocytic myocarditis is common, linked to viral infections. It shows lymphocytes in the heart muscle, indicating an immune response. Viral myocarditis is another type, caused by viruses directly affecting the heart muscle. Other types include giant cell myocarditis and eosinophilic myocarditis, each with unique features.

Understanding these types helps in diagnosing and treating myocarditis. Accurate diagnosis is key to managing the condition.

Common Causes of Myocarditis

Common Causes of Myocarditis
Myocarditis: Amazing New Ways Doctors Find It 6

It’s important to know what causes myocarditis to treat it well. Myocarditis can come from infections or autoimmune diseases.

Viral Infections

Viral infections are a big reason for myocarditis. Viruses like coxsackievirus, adenovirus, and parvovirus B19 often cause it. These viruses attack the heart muscle, causing inflammation and damage.

Seeing how viruses cause myocarditis shows why we need to look at the whole health picture and possible virus exposure.

Bacterial and Fungal Causes

Bacterial and fungal infections can also cause myocarditis, but they’re less common. Bacteria like staphylococcus and streptococcus can do it, mainly in people with heart problems or weak immune systems.

Fungal infections are rare but serious, mostly in those with weakened immune systems.

Autoimmune Conditions

Autoimmune diseases are another big reason for myocarditis. Conditions like lupus and rheumatoid arthritis can cause it because the body attacks the heart tissue.

It’s key to understand how autoimmune diseases and myocarditis are linked to manage patients with these conditions.

Cause

Description

Examples

Viral Infections

Viruses directly infect the heart muscle

Coxsackievirus, Adenovirus, Parvovirus B19

Bacterial and Fungal Infections

Infections caused by bacteria or fungi

Staphylococcus, Streptococcus, Fungal infections in immunocompromised

Autoimmune Conditions

Immune system attacks the heart tissue

Lupus, Rheumatoid Arthritis

Initial Clinical Assessment for Myocarditis

Diagnosing myocarditis starts with a detailed clinical check-up. This first step is key to spotting patients who might have myocarditis. It also helps decide what tests to do next.

Medical History Evaluation

Looking closely at a patient’s medical history is vital. Doctors will ask about symptoms, when they started, and how they’ve changed. They’ll also ask about recent infections, toxin exposure, and past heart problems.

Key elements of the medical history include:

  • Recent viral or bacterial infections
  • Exposure to toxins or chemicals
  • History of autoimmune disorders
  • Previous cardiac conditions or surgeries

Physical Examination Findings

The physical exam gives clues about myocarditis. Doctors might find signs like a fast heartbeat, irregular rhythms, or heart murmurs.

Important physical examination findings may include:

  • Tachycardia or bradycardia
  • Irregular heart rhythms or arrhythmias
  • Heart murmurs or abnormal heart sounds
  • Signs of heart failure, such as jugular venous distension or peripheral edema

Laboratory Tests for Detecting Myocarditis

Myocarditis detection relies heavily on laboratory tests. These include cardiac biomarkers and inflammatory markers. These tests are key for diagnosing the condition and understanding its severity.

Cardiac Biomarkers

Cardiac biomarkers are substances released into the blood when the heart is damaged. The most commonly used cardiac biomarkers for diagnosing myocarditis include:

  • Troponin: Elevated troponin levels are a sensitive indicator of heart muscle damage.
  • Creatine Kinase (CK): CK-MB is a specific isoform of creatine kinase that is associated with heart muscle damage.

Inflammatory Markers

Inflammatory markers are used to assess the level of inflammation in the body. This can be indicative of myocarditis. Common inflammatory markers include:

  • C-Reactive Protein (CRP): Elevated CRP levels indicate inflammation.
  • Erythrocyte Sedimentation Rate (ESR): ESR measures the rate at which red blood cells settle, indicating inflammation.

These markers help in understanding the inflammatory process associated with myocarditis.

Other Relevant Blood Tests

In addition to cardiac biomarkers and inflammatory markers, other blood tests may be conducted. These include:

Blood Test

Purpose

Complete Blood Count (CBC)

To assess overall health and detect a range of conditions, including infection and inflammation.

Viral Titers

To identify viral infections that may be causing myocarditis.

Autoantibody Tests

To check for autoimmune conditions that could be contributing to myocarditis.

These tests collectively contribute to a complete understanding of the patient’s condition. They aid in the diagnosis and management of myocarditis.

Advanced Imaging in Myocarditis Diagnosis

Advanced imaging has changed how we diagnose myocarditis. It gives us detailed views of the heart’s condition.

Echocardiography

Echocardiography uses sound waves to show the heart’s images. It’s often the first test for myocarditis. It can spot heart function issues like a low ejection fraction.

Cardiac MRI

Cardiac MRI is key for seeing heart inflammation and scarring. It shows the heart’s structure and function. This helps find myocarditis.

Chest X-ray

A Chest X-ray shows heart size and lung issues. It’s not specific for myocarditis but helps check heart health.

Nuclear Imaging Techniques

Nuclear imaging techniques like Gallium-67 scintigraphy and PET find inflammation. They use tiny amounts of radioactive material to see heart activity.

These advanced imaging methods have made diagnosing and treating myocarditis better. They help doctors understand the condition fully, leading to better care.

Electrocardiogram (ECG) in Myocarditis Detection

An electrocardiogram (ECG) is a common tool in diagnosing myocarditis. It’s a non-invasive test that shows the heart’s electrical activity. This helps doctors understand heart rhythm and spot any issues.

Common ECG Abnormalities

In patients with myocarditis, ECGs can show several problems, including:

  • Arrhythmias: irregular heartbeats that can be a sign of cardiac muscle inflammation.
  • ST-segment changes: alterations in the ST segment can indicate myocardial injury.
  • T-wave inversion: T-wave changes can suggest ischemia or inflammation of the heart muscle.
  • Conduction abnormalities: myocarditis can affect the heart’s electrical conduction system, leading to blocks or delays.

Limitations of ECG in Diagnosis

ECG is helpful in spotting myocarditis but has its limits. It might miss mild cases or early stages. Also, ECG signs can look similar in other heart issues.

So, doctors must look at ECG results along with the patient’s symptoms, medical history, and other tests. A full diagnostic approach is key to correctly diagnose myocarditis.

Endomyocardial Biopsy: The Definitive Diagnostic Tool

The endomyocardial biopsy is the top choice for diagnosing myocarditis. It lets doctors look at the heart muscle directly. This way, they can say for sure if someone has myocarditis.

Procedure and Process

An endomyocardial biopsy takes a small piece of heart tissue for study. It’s done in a special lab. A thin tube is inserted through a vein to reach the heart.

A tool called a bioptome then grabs tiny bits of heart muscle. These bits are checked under a microscope for signs of damage or inflammation. This helps doctors confirm myocarditis and figure out what might have caused it.

Risks and Considerations

Even though it’s safe, there are risks with endomyocardial biopsy. These include bleeding, damage to the heart valve, or irregular heartbeats. But these serious problems are rare.

Before the biopsy, talk to your doctor about the risks and benefits. This helps make sure it’s the right choice for you.

Interpretation of Results

A pathologist checks the biopsy samples for signs of myocarditis. They look for inflammation or scarring. Finding certain cells or damage patterns can help diagnose myocarditis and sometimes find its cause.

The biopsy results help doctors decide how to treat you. They can also give clues about how well you might recover.

Differential Diagnosis: Conditions That Mimic Myocarditis

Distinguishing myocarditis from other conditions is key. Myocarditis is an inflammatory heart condition. Its symptoms are often similar to other heart and non-heart issues.

Other Cardiac Conditions

Many heart conditions can look like myocarditis. It’s important to think about these when diagnosing. These include:

  • Acute Coronary Syndrome: This can cause chest pain and high heart enzyme levels, just like myocarditis.
  • Pericarditis: This inflammation of the heart sac can cause chest pain and ECG changes, making it hard to tell apart from myocarditis.
  • Cardiomyopathies: Different types of heart muscle disease can have symptoms similar to myocarditis.

Non-cardiac Conditions

Non-heart conditions can also look like myocarditis. This makes diagnosis harder. These include:

  • Pulmonary Embolism: A big blood clot in the lungs can cause heart strain, similar to myocarditis.
  • Gastrointestinal Issues: Problems like acid reflux or pancreatitis can cause chest pain, making it seem like myocarditis.
  • Anxiety and Panic Disorders: These can cause symptoms that seem like heart problems, including myocarditis.

Importance of Accurate Diagnosis

Getting the right diagnosis for myocarditis is very important. Here’s why:

  1. Appropriate Treatment: Each condition needs its own treatment. Wrong treatment can make things worse.
  2. Prognosis: Knowing the exact condition helps predict the outcome better.
  3. Prevention of Complications: Misdiagnosis can lead to serious problems. For example, untreated myocarditis can cause heart failure or irregular heartbeats.

Condition

Similarities with Myocarditis

Distinguishing Features

Acute Coronary Syndrome

Chest pain, elevated cardiac biomarkers

Coronary artery occlusion on angiography

Pericarditis

Chest pain, ECG changes

Pericardial effusion on echocardiography

Pulmonary Embolism

Acute right heart strain

Evidence of embolism on CT pulmonary angiography

In conclusion, figuring out what’s wrong when someone might have myocarditis is very important. Evaluating other cardiac and non-cardiac conditions ensures that doctors provide the appropriate treatment.

Treatment Approaches for Myocarditis

Managing myocarditis well needs a mix of care, medicines, and advanced treatments. The right treatment depends on how bad the condition is, what caused it, and the patient’s health.

Supportive Care

Supportive care is key in treating myocarditis. It aims to ease symptoms and boost heart function. This care includes:

  • Rest and less physical activity to ease heart strain
  • Regular heart function checks and tests
  • Handling symptoms like pain and swelling

Rest and Recovery are essential for myocarditis patients. They help the heart work less and recover better. Doctors often tell patients to avoid hard activities during the illness’s early stages.

Medication Options

There are many medicines for myocarditis, based on the cause and any complications. These include:

  1. Anti-inflammatory drugs to cut down inflammation and ease symptoms
  2. Antiviral or antibacterial drugs if the myocarditis is from an infection
  3. Medicines for heart failure or irregular heartbeats if they happen

Anti-inflammatory medicines, like NSAIDs or corticosteroids, are often used. They help reduce inflammation and manage symptoms of myocarditis.

Advanced Treatments for Severe Cases

For very severe myocarditis, more advanced treatments might be needed. These include:

  • Intravenous immunoglobulin (IVIG) therapy to control the immune system
  • Mechanical circulatory support devices, like left ventricular assist devices (LVADs), for severe heart failure
  • Heart transplantation for irreversible heart damage

The aim of treatment is to support the heart during myocarditis, handle complications, and avoid lasting damage. A detailed treatment plan helps doctors improve outcomes for myocarditis patients.
